VERTICAL ELECTRONIC GLASS DRILLING MACHINE
MODEL: PRIAM
YEAR OF MANUFACTURE: 2026 / BRAND NEW
The Priam model is a vertical glass drilling machine with two drilling spindles (double-sided), designed for customers seeking a functional and easy-to-operate machine that is also long-lasting. In developing this machine, we relied on traditional mechanical engineering principles—using heavy, heat-treated steel frames and mechanical solutions—to facilitate future operation and maintenance. Thanks to this distinct approach to machine design and manufacturing, our machine can drill glass for many years without interruptions, ensuring a multiple return on investment.
To ensure the components of our glass drilling machine are manufactured with the utmost precision, we produce them in Poland in collaboration with local partners. The main frame of the machine is produced in-house, then heat-treated and further processed by local workshops. This allows us to maintain strict supervision throughout the entire production process, detecting and correcting any defects before the product is delivered to the customer. In this way, we also support the local machinery industry.
The assemblies used in the machine comply with the highest European standards. Our suppliers include: SIEMENS, HITACHI, UNITRONICS, SCHNEIDER, GARLOCK. All mechanical components are readily available and can be quickly and easily replaced during machine operation.
Expoglass Priam – Glass Drilling Machine – Top-Level Functionality
⦁ 2 drilling spindles (front and rear). These allow drilling through a glass pane in a single operation without needing to turn the glass over.

⦁ Electronically controlled loading bar. To set the distance between the lower glass edge and the drill hole, simply enter the desired measurement via a touchscreen; the machine will then automatically move to the correct position.
⦁ Quick drill-change mode. When the drill change button is pressed, both spindles are automatically locked (they cannot be rotated). The vertical plate between the two drills moves downwards, creating ample space between the drills. This allows for tool-free removal of the drills and provides generous room for convenient access.
⦁ Automatic (electronic) measurement of drill length and drill position. After a drill change is completed, an automatic calibration process takes place: the machine measures the drill length. This determines the distance between the glass pane and each drill tip, which is particularly important in small workshops where single-piece production is common.
⦁ Automatic (electronic) determination of spindle depth positions. After the automatic spindle calibration and pressing the glass pane in place, the machine measures the glass thickness and automatically sets the optimal spindle depth positions. The operator then only needs to press the 'Drill' button; the drilling process proceeds fully automatically.
